Definition of a nerd

A “nerd” is someone who knows a lot about a certain subject or niche area and they may be obsessive about the topic. Nerds can have a unique or unusual way of looking at life. People sometimes think of them as shy or awkward in social situations, and they may be very interested in intelligent activities or hobbies that are not usually considered common.

How to deal with being called a nerd

Nerds are usually judged based on the stuff they’re into. And it’s pretty annoying when people judge you. So, here’s the deal on how to handle it when people call you a nerd:

1. Don’t be afraid to follow your interests: There’s nothing wrong with being passionate about something. even if it’s not usually thought of as a popular thing. Enjoy your own hobbies and interests, and don’t let what other people say about them change how you feel about them.

2. Help people understand: If you hear someone using the word “nerd” in an insulting manner, you should try to explain what it means. Tell them what’s good about being interested in and knowledgeable about a certain subject. No one can teach them better than someone who has been in those shoes.

3. Be with people who are open-minded like you: Put yourself around people who share your hobbies and goals. 

4. Don’t let it bother you: It doesn’t say anything about who you are or how important you are. So, if someone calls you a nerd, try not to take it too badly. Instead, focus on the good things about yourself and your life.

5. Keep your confidence up: It’s important to keep your confidence up when dealing with mean words or stereotypes. Have confidence in who you are and the things that make you happy, and don’t let what other people say get you down.

Jennifer Garner felt like a nerd in high school

Jennifer Garner Via Wikipedia

Jennifer Garner now has millions of fans but she claims when she was young she was pretty nerdy and never part of the in crowd.

I was a real nerd. I wasn’t the popular one, I was one of those girls on the edge of the group. I never wore the right clothes and I had a kind of natural geekiness. I was in the school band and I think that has a bit of a stigma at the age of 13. If you’d asked me what I wanted to be, I would have said something like a librarian.” – Jennifer Garner

Famous people who have been called nerds

A lot of famous people have been called “nerds,” which is usually a compliment because it shows how smart and intelligent they are in a certain subject. Some examples are as follows:

1. Bill Gates: The man who helped start Microsoft is frequently referred to as a “nerd”.  This is because of his intense interest in new technologies and his profound understanding of computer programming.

2. Elon Musk: The main man of SpaceX and Tesla, is known for his enthusiasm for technology and engineering. Elon is frequently described to as a “tech nerd” or a “space nerd.”

3. Mark Zuckerberg: People often call the cofounder of Facebook a “nerd” because he is very interested in computer programming and it has made him a billionaire! He also does very well in the area of information technology.

4. Neil deGrasse Tyson: The scientist is known for his deep knowledge of astronomy. He is also a science communicator who has a passion for getting scientific information out to the public.

5. Stephen Hawking: He was best known for his groundbreaking work in the area of theoretical physics. He was often called a “nerd” because of how smart he was in school and how much he liked science.

Just remember, being called a “nerd” isn’t a bad thing. It’s actually a compliment that recognizes someone’s knowledge and passion for a specific subject.
